Drug abusers experience the following scenario: The pleasure given by their drug (or drugs) of choice is so strong that it is difficult to eradicate even after years of staying away from the substances involved. Certain triggers may cause a drug abuser to relapse. Research shows that long-term drug abuse results in significant changes in brain function that persist long after an individual stops using drugs. It is most important to realize that the same is true of not just illegal substances but alcohol and tobacco as well.

The toxic levels for lithium carbonate are close to the therapeutic levels. Signs of toxicity include fine hand tremor, polyuria, mild thirst, nausea, general discomfort, diarrhea, vomiting, drowsiness, muscular weakness, lack of coordination, ataxia, giddiness, tinnitus, and blurred vision.

Amphetamine poisoning can cause intravascular coagulation, circulatory collapse, rhabdomyolysis, ischemic colitis, acute psychosis, hyperthermia, respiratory distress syndrome, and pericarditis.
